Tire Brands and Options
Farm & Fleet Morton generally carries a selection of national and regional tire brands, balancing well-known names with value-oriented options. The exact mix depends on current inventory, so calling ahead is recommended if you have a preferred brand or specific tire size. Staff can often advise on suitable alternatives when a requested tire is out of stock.
Tire Categories Commonly Available
| Category | Typical Use Case | Notes on Availability |
|---|---|---|
| All-season passenger tires | Year-round commuting and everyday driving | Usually in stock in common sizes |
| Touring and performance passenger tires | Quiet ride and improved handling | May require special order |
| Light truck and SUV tires | Heavier loads and occasional off-road use | Often available in popular sizes |
| Winter and snow tires | Cold-weather traction when roads are snowy | Seasonal availability; best to pre-order |

Quick Comparison: Store vs. Dealer vs. Independent Shop
| Option | Typical Price Level | Service Speed | Specialist Access |
|---|---|---|---|
| Farm & Fleet store | Mid-range, with promotions | Moderate, depends on appointment load | General service; referrals for complex work |
| New car dealer | Higher, sometimes warranty-related | Structured scheduling | Factory-trained technicians for specific brands |
| Independent shop | Variable, can be lower | Variable, often flexible | Varies by shop expertise |
Warranty, Returns, and Guarantees
Tires and parts sold at Farm & Fleet Morton typically come with the manufacturer’s warranty, and the store may offer its own limited satisfaction guarantee for services. Installation and repair work are usually covered for a specified period, but specifics depend on the item and the store policy at the time of purchase. Asking for written confirmation of coverage helps avoid confusion later.
What to Confirm Before Service
- Length of warranty or guarantee on tires and repairs
- Whether installation is included in the tire price
- Restrictions or requirements for returning parts or service
- Who handles adjustments or fixes if an issue appears shortly after service
